ABSTRACT

Objective:To develop an in vitro neuroinflammation model by establishing a microglia-neuron co-culture system. Methods:Mouse microglia (BV-2), motor neurons (NSC34) and hippocampal neurons (HT-22) were selected.This experiment was performed in two parts.Experiment Ⅰ BV-2 microglia were stimulated with different concentrations of lipopolysaccharide (LPS, 10, 100, 500 and 1 000 ng/ml). Microglia culture supernatant(Conditioned Medium) was extracted and two types of neurons were cultured separately.The concentration of LPS that resulted in a significant 50% decrease in neuronal viability was selected using the CCK-8 method for establishment of the Transwell co-culture system.Experiment Ⅱ Microglia were cultured in the upper chamber of Transwell, and neurons were seeded in the lower chamber.Microglia were divided into 2 groups ( n=12 each) using the random number table method: control group and LPS group.In control group and LPS group, microglia were cultured for 6 h with cell culture medium and LPS, respectively, then the medium was replaced with fresh medium, microglia were continuously incubated for 12 h, and then the cells in the upper and lower chambers were combined.The cells were incubated using the BV-2-NSC34 Transwell co-culture system for 12 h and using the BV-2-HT-22 Transwell co-culture system for 24 h. The concentrations of interleukin-1beta (IL-1β) and IL-18 in neuronal culture supernatant were measured by enzyme-linked immunosorbent assay, the apoptotic rate of neurons was determined by flow cytometry, the expression of Bcl-2 and Bax mRNA in neurons was detected by quantitative real-time polymerase chain reaction, and the expression of cleaved caspase-3, Bcl-2 and Bax in neurons was detected by Western blot. Results:Experiment Ⅰ LPS concentration for stimulation was 10 ng/ml in BV-2-NSC34 Transwell co-culture system and 1, 000 ng/ml in BV-2-HT-22 Transwell co-culture system.Experiment Ⅱ Compared with control group, the concentrations of IL-1β and IL-18 and apoptotic rate of neurons were significantly increased, Bax protein and mRNA expression was up-regulated, Bcl-2 protein and mRNA expression was down-regulated, and cleaved caspase-3 expression was up-regulated in LPS group ( P<0.05 or 0.01). Conclusions:The microglia-neuron co-culture system is successfully established by the conditioned medium technique and Transwell co-culture system, which provides an experimental protocol for establishment of neuroinflammation models associated with postoperative cognitive dysfunction.

ABSTRACT

This paper introduces a fast repair methods of Versa HD volume-modulated accelerator's high voltage circuit fault:the key points test method. To identify five key points:①Enter maintenance mode to check for AFC deviation; ② The magnetron waveform MI and PFN waveform PFN V are detected on the maintenance terminal board; ③ Detect thyratron waveform; ④ Check the supply voltage of thyratron; ⑤ HT PSU 600 V DC test 600 V normal or not. The waveform or voltage is also measured to efficiently narrow the fault range to find out the cause of the fault, quickly remove the fault.

ABSTRACT

Objective:To explore the risk factors of acute epididymo-orchitis after transurethral plasma enucleation and resection of prostate (TUERP).Methods:The clinical data of 710 patients with benign prostatic hyperplasia (BPH) from June 2015 to September 2018 in the Second Hospital of Dalian Medical University were retrospectively analyzed. Among them, 220 cases were treated with TUERP and 490 cases were treated with transurethral resection of prostate (TURP). The incidence of postoperative acute epididymo-orchitis was compared between 2 groups and the risk factors of acute epididymo-orchitis were analyzed.Results:The incidence of epididymo-orchitis in TUERP patients was significantly higher than that in TURP patients: 9.55% (21/220) vs. 4.08% (20/490), and there was statistical difference ( χ2 = 8.33, P<0.01). Univariate analysis result showed that diabetes mellitus, postoperative indwelling catheterization > 3 d, preoperative leukocyte positive, prostate volume > 80 ml and operation time > 90 min were the risk factors of acute epididymo-orchitis after TUERP ( P<0.01 or <0.05). Logistic regression analysis result showed that prostate volume > 80 ml and postoperative indwelling catheterization > 3 d were the independent risk factors of acute epididymo-orchitis after TUERP ( OR = 12.402 and 3.642, 95% CI 4.581 to 33.579 and 1.218 to 11.204, P<0.01 or <0.05). Conclusions:Prostate volume > 80 ml and postoperative indwelling catheterization > 3 d are independent risk factors of acute epididymo-orchitis after TUERP.

ABSTRACT

In this paper, an effective method was proposed for rapid positioning and repair of medical Clinac and helical tomotherapy "GAS" interlock fault. The infrared refrigerant leakage detector was combined with soap bubbles for leakuseage detection. The sandpaper and file were utilized to gently grind the leakage point and the surrounding 5 mm-wide waveguide surface,and then the high-power electric soldering iron of 150 W was adopted to make up for the leakage. The leakage point was detected by rapid positioning, and no leakage was found in the waveguide after 12 years of use. This approach can significantly reduce the difficulty in the repair of the Clinac and helical tomotherapy"GAS" interlock fault.

ABSTRACT

Objective To propose a method to improve the efficiency and accuracy of the Pinnacle treatment planning system in searching for a certain patient. Methods The original Pinnacle system was modified by adding a button of"Search Patient" in the window of"Patient Select" to call a self-built window of"Search Patient by MRN or Name". After inputting the patient′s Medical Record Number or Name, a self-built script file was called to quickly find and locate the patient′s record. Results The patient′s MRN or Name was input in the window of"Search Patient by MRN or Name",and then input"Enter" or clicked the button of Search to rapidly identify the patient and enhance the search efficiency. Conclusion The openness and script of the Pinnacle system can be utilized to modify and improve and supplement the existing func-tions.

ABSTRACT

Objective To explore the influences of proliferation and differentiation of preadipocytes on high fat diet-induced obesity and obesity prevention through exercises in rats.Methods Forty male Sprague-Dawley rats were divided into a normal diet control group (C,n=8),a normal diet with exercises group (E,n=8),a high fat diet control group (H,n=14) and a high fat diet with exercises group (HE,n=10).Group C and group H kept sedentary,while group E and group HE underwent treadmill exercises at about 75%VO2max level.After 12 weeks of intervention,the body weight,epididymal,perirenal and retroperitoneal fat mass were recorded,and the total fat mass was determinated.Stereology method was used to calculate the number and average diameter of fat cells.Western Blotting was conducted to measure the expression of PPARγ and C/EBPα protein in adipose tissues.Results (1) The body weight and total fat mass of group H were significantly higher than those of group C (P<0.01).Perirenal,retroperitoneal fat and total fat mass of group E and HE were significantly lower than those of group C and H respectively (P<0.01).(2) The total fat cell number of group H was significantly higher than that of group C.The average diameter of fat cells in perirenal and retroperitoneal fat pads of group E were significantly lower than that of group C (P<0.05,P<0.01),while that of group HE in epididymal,perirenal and retroperitoneal fat pads was significantly lower than that of group H (P<0.01).(3) Compared with group C,the expression of PPARγ protein of group E and H increased significantly in epididymal,perirenal and retroperitoneal fat pads (P<0.01).The expression of C/EBPα protein of group H was significantly higher than that of group C in epididymal and perirenal fat pads (P<0.01),the expression of C/EBPα protein of group E was significantly higher than that of group C in perirenal and retroperitoneal fat pads (P<0.01),while the expression of C/EBPα protein of group HE was significantly lower than that of group H in perirenal fat pads(P<0.01).Conclusion The proliferation and differentiation of preadipocyte was enhanced in the development of high fat diet induced obesity and exercises to prevent obesity,but its role and mechanisms were different.The high fat diet increases the number of fat cells which is a compensatory mechanism for the body to adapt to fat accumulation,while exercises might promote cell renewal and decrease the average size of fat cells which is an adaptive mechanism to improve fat storage.

ABSTRACT

Objective To observe the contribution of acute normovolemic hemodilution ( ANH) in experiment of cryopreserved dog limb replantation.Methods Sixteen healthy Beagle dogs (male:female=1:1) were divided into two groups.Dogs in the experiment group ( Group B) received ANH in the limb replantation, and dogs in the control group ( Group A) received the same amount of lactate Ringer’ s solution intravenously during the surgical operation.We recorded and compared the hemodynamic indexes, HB, HCT, the resuscitation time, the first rising head time, the first standing time and the first eating and drinking time between the two groups.Results ( 1 ) During the operation, both PaO2 and PCO2 in the two groups were normal, as well as the breathing rate.The heart rate in the group B was lower than that in the group A.Before blood transfusion, there was no statistically significant difference in HB and HCT between the two groups, but after transfusion they were significantly higher in the group B than in the group A.(2) The resuscitation time, the first rising head time, the first standing time and the first eating and drinking time of the group B were all better than those in the group A.Conclusions In cryopreserved dog limb replantation experiments, acute normovolemic hemodilution is helpful to improve the general condition and facilitate the recovery of animals after limb replantation.

ABSTRACT

Objective To explore the relationship between the level of plasma homocysteine(HCY)and intima-media thickness(IMT)with incipient cerebral infarction.Methods According to the clinical diagnostic criteria,112 patients with incipient cerebral infarction were randomly selected as the cerebral infarction group,and 102 healthy people were randomly selected as the control group.All carotid arteries of both groups were checked by carotid artery ultrasound and IMT was tested.The levels of plasma HCY and plasma folate as well as vitamin B12 were measured in both groups by chemiluminescence immunoassay.Results The plasma HCY level in the cerebral infarction group [(24.89 ± 1.96) μmol/L] was significantly higher than (8.58 ± 2.34) μmol/L in the control group (P < 0.01).The levels of plasma folate [(4.79 ± 2.35) μg/L] and vitamin B12 [(228.67 ± 114.75) ng/L] in the cerebral infarction group were significantly lower than [(8.65 ± 2.64) μg/L and (320.53 ± 154.78) ng/L] of the control group (P < 0.01).The IMT of the cerebral infarction group [respectively the left common carotid artery fork (1.12 ± 0.25) mm,the right common carotid artery fork(1.09 ± 0.28) mm,the left internal carotid artery(1.18 ± 0.23) mm,the right internal carotid artery(1.03 ± 0.24)mm] were obviously higher than those of the control group[respectively the left common carotid artery fork (0.65 ± 0.18) mm,the right common carotid artery fork (0.61 ± 0.24) mm,the left internal carotid artery(0.58 ±0.22)mm,the right internal carotid artery(0.61 ±0.19)mm] (P <0.05).Significant positive correlation between IMT and HCY was found in patients with cerebral infarction(r =0.834,P < 0.01),but no corre lation was found in the control group(r =0.081,P > 0.05).Conclusion The increase of plasma HCY and the thickening of IMT are closely related with incipient cerebral infarction.Examination of plasma HCY and IMT has important clinical significance for the secondary prevention of incipient cerebral infarction.

ABSTRACT

Objective To evaluate the effect of percutaneous coronary intervention(PCI) on myocardial perfusion in coronary heart.Methods Fourty-two patients with coronary heart disease who were confirmed to have coronary artery steonsis by the coronary angiography were selected.They were checked by myocardial contrast echocardiography of intravenous before and after treatment by PCI.Then we determined quantitatively the perfusion of coronary microcirculation based on the extent of myocardial imaging and recorded it images.The myocardial contrast echocardiography result was compared before and after treatment by PCI for evaluating the situation of myocardial perfusion and effect of PCL So we can estimte the patients' prognosis.Results There were 39 eases of 42 patients with PCI that their lesion vascular were all opening and unblocked.Repeated radiography showed that their TIMI blood flow was the third level.The partial cross sectional area of all the capillaries [A =15.46 ± 3.27) min] blood flow velocity [β =(0.75 ±0.16)min/s],and myocardial blood flow volume[A - β =(12.00 ±4.51 ) min2/s] dependent on myocardial segments all increased more significantly than those before the PCI[A =(6.68 ± 1.76) min,β =(0.40 ± 0.12) min/s、A · β =(2.82 ± 1.38 ) min2/s] (t =37.2527.58、30.65,P < 0.05 ).After PCI three months the EF value of follow-up patients was increased mote than that of before PCI (t =13.77,P < 0.01 )but the scoring index of ventricular wall motion was decreased more than that of before PCI ( t =8.75,P < 0.01 ).Correlation analysis showed that after PCI A,β,A · β all had a strong correlation ( every P < 0.01 ).Conclusion PCI could effectively improve the situation of myocardial perfusion in myocardial infarction patients.It could save ischemia myocardial in infarction field and also improve the function of left ventricular if patients implemented PCI operation as soon as possible.

ABSTRACT

At present, the assessment of the same hospital at the same time by different means may lead to different assessment results, viz. there may be a variety (inconsistency) of assessment results. This can be chiefly attributed to the variety of assessment systems, with different assessment indexes and assessment methods, and to the variety of people making the assessments and assessing environments. Integrated measures can be taken in order to render assessment results more accurate: ① refusing to have blind faith in any particular method; ② seeing clearly assessment goals and features; ③ properly selecting index systems for the assessment; ④ correctly fixing the weights for indexes; ⑤ appropriately selecting assessment methods; ⑥ making combined use of various methods; ⑦ pooling the results from different assessment methods.
